Understanding Windows Modules Installer Worker in Task Manager
The Windows Modules Installer Worker, also known as TiWorker.exe, is a process in the Task Manager that is responsible for installing, uninstalling, and modifying Windows updates and components. It is an essential part of the Windows operating system and plays a crucial role in keeping your computer secure and up to date.
What Does Windows Modules Installer Worker Do?
Windows Modules Installer Worker works in the background to ensure that your operating system is up to date with the latest patches, bug fixes, and security improvements. It monitors your system for any new updates released by Microsoft and handles the installation process. It also manages the removal of outdated or unwanted Windows components.
When a new update is available, Windows Modules Installer Worker downloads the necessary files from Microsoft servers and installs them on your computer. This process is essential for maintaining the stability, performance, and security of your operating system. By regularly updating Windows, you can ensure that your system is protected against known vulnerabilities.
Windows Modules Installer Worker also performs maintenance tasks, such as optimizing the Windows component store and repairing corrupted system files. It helps keep your system running smoothly and resolves any issues that may arise due to outdated or damaged system files.
Why Is Windows Modules Installer Worker Using High CPU?
Sometimes, you may notice that the Windows Modules Installer Worker process is using a significant amount of CPU resources, causing your computer's performance to slow down. This high CPU usage is temporary and typically occurs when the process is installing or uninstalling updates or performing maintenance tasks.
During these periods, the Windows Modules Installer Worker process prioritizes its tasks, which can result in increased resource usage. Once the installation or maintenance process is complete, the CPU usage should return to normal. It is important to note that the high CPU usage is a temporary inconvenience and not a cause for concern.
If you notice that the high CPU usage persists for an extended period or if it is causing significant performance issues, there may be an underlying issue with the Windows Update service or a specific update. In such cases, it is recommended to troubleshoot the issue or seek assistance from Microsoft's support team.

2. Can I disable the Windows Modules Installer Worker?
While it is not recommended to disable the Windows Modules Installer Worker completely, you can temporarily stop its operation if you are experiencing significant performance issues. To do this:
- Open the Task Manager by pressing Ctrl+Shift+Esc on your keyboard.
- Navigate to the Processes or Details tab.
- Find the Windows Modules Installer Worker (TiWorker.exe) process.
- Right-click on it and select "End task" or "End process."
Keep in mind that disabling the Windows Modules Installer Worker may prevent Windows updates from installing correctly, leaving your computer vulnerable to security risks. It is advisable to only stop the process temporarily and allow it to resume once your computer's performance improves.

4. Why does the Windows Modules Installer Worker process use high CPU and disk usage?
The Windows Modules Installer Worker process can use high CPU and disk usage due to the nature of its operations. When installing or uninstalling Windows updates and components, the process needs to access and modify various system files and registry entries. These operations can be resource-intensive and may cause temporary spikes in CPU and disk usage.
If you notice that the Windows Modules Installer Worker consistently uses high CPU and disk usage even when there are no pending updates, there may be an underlying issue. In such cases, it is recommended to run a virus scan, check for system errors, and ensure that your operating system is up to date.
